
If you are managing the gluster volume through ovirt, you could just select the volume in the ui and click "Optimize for virt store". It does the job of setting the required parameters for the volume. Thanks, Kanagaraj On 03/02/2015 10:44 PM, Jason Brooks wrote:

After a couple of hours, the chown 36:36 did the trick, now I have the domain up. This is a good way to set those perms and make them stick:
gluster volume set $yourvol storage.owner-uid 36 gluster volume set $yourvol storage.owner-gid 36

First, You need to create gluster volume. Do not forget to start the volume. then the "chown 36:36 <volume directory name>"
now you need to create new glusterfs domain, and to point to the <gluster server name:/volume name>
